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i vorhandenes tabsheet neu erstellen (https://www.delphipraxis.net/4287-vorhandenes-tabsheet-neu-erstellen.html)

Basic-Master 22. Apr 2003 20:37


vorhandenes tabsheet neu erstellen
 
Hi,
wisst ihr, wie man n vorhandenes tabsheet nochmal neu in nem pagecontrol erstellen kann (mit dem kompletten inhalt)?

Daniel B 22. Apr 2003 20:46

Hallo,

einfach alles markieren, Kopieren und auf dem neuen Einfügen. ;)

Grüsse, Daniel :hi:

Basic-Master 22. Apr 2003 20:47

Zitat:

Zitat von Daniel B
Hallo,

einfach alles markieren, Kopieren und auf dem neuen Einfügen. ;)

Grüsse, Daniel :hi:

das ist klar, allerdings bräuchte ich es in der runtime mit code

Basic-Master 23. Apr 2003 21:51

wisst ihr denn nix :(

Daniel B 23. Apr 2003 22:02

Hallo,

nun, ich glaube nicht dass das schon jemand versucht hat.
Du musst mit FindComponent alle Komponenten suchen, Top, Left, Name usw. merken und auf dem neuen erzeugen, viel Spass beim schreiben. ;)

Grüsse, Daniel :hi:

Marco Haffner 23. Apr 2003 22:26

Wofür denn zur Laufzeit neu erstellen?
Vielleicht dan ganzen Tabsheet in ein Stream speichern und der PageControl neu zuweisen?

Daniel B 23. Apr 2003 22:30

Mir fällt irgendwie überhaupt kein Grund ein warum man dies machen sollte.
Ne Idee?

Grüsse, Daniel :hi:

Basic-Master 24. Apr 2003 08:49

Zitat:

Zitat von Daniel B
Mir fällt irgendwie überhaupt kein Grund ein warum man dies machen sollte.
Ne Idee?

Grüsse, Daniel :hi:

ja hab ich: ich will n tabsheet mit synedit und son paar anderen komponenten verdoppeln, weil jedes synedit seine eigenen eigenschaften wie selstart, undolist, redolist etc. hat, aber eigentlich nur wegen redolist und undolist, weil man die net kopieren kann... hmm das mit tstream hört sich gut an, wie könnte man sowas umsetzen?

Tom 24. Apr 2003 09:08

Ein TabControl (satt PageControl) ist nichts für Dich?

Basic-Master 24. Apr 2003 09:16

Zitat:

Zitat von Tom
Ein TabControl (satt PageControl) ist nichts für Dich?

nicht wirklich... wegen der undo- und redolist hab ich da probleme, die lässt sich net abspeichern, hab schon versucht arrays als TSynEditUndoList zu deklarieren, aber da kommt dann ne meldung das es unbekannt wäre... deswegen bräuchte ich das pagecontrol+tabsheets :|


Alle Zeitangaben in WEZ +1. Es ist jetzt 20:21 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z